Putney Artist Barbara Garber at The Putney School


Date & Time: 
Mar 8 2013 - 4:00pm - 6:00pm

The Micheal S. Currier Center Gallery at The Putney School, is proud to announce an exhibition of new work by Putney artist, Barbara Garber. The show will feature drawings and paintings and will be on view from Friday, March 8th-Saturday, May 4th, 2013. There will be an opening reception for the artist on Friday, March 8th from 4-6 PM. This exhibition is supported in part by the Vermont Arts Council and The National Endowment For The Arts. For directions to The Putney School please visit www.putneyschool.org.
